

AWS Mainframe Modernization Service (Managed Runtime Environment experience) is no longer open to new customers. For capabilities similar to AWS Mainframe Modernization Service (Managed Runtime Environment experience) explore AWS Mainframe Modernization Service (Self-Managed Experience). Existing customers can continue to use the service as normal. For more information, see [AWS Mainframe Modernization availability change](https://docs.aws.amazon.com/m2/latest/userguide/mainframe-modernization-availability-change.html).

# Refactoring applications automatically with AWS Transform for mainframe
<a name="refactoring-m2"></a>

Automated refactoring with AWS Transform for mainframe provides an end-to-end solution for migrating and modernizing your mainframe applications. The steps in the refactoring process are as follows:
+ Analyze inventory
+ Analyze dependencies
+ Automatically transform code
+ Capture and manage test scenarios

You can complete the previous steps in the AWS Transform for mainframe refactor tool, available through single sign-on from the AWS Mainframe Modernization console. For more information on AWS Transform for mainframe refactor, see the [AWS Transform for mainframe refactor documentation](https://bluinsights.aws/docs/). 

 When you are satisfied with the transformed source code, it's time to move to AWS: **build** and **deploy** the refactored application using [AWS Transform for mainframe Runtime](ba-runtime-options.md).

This guide will help you understand the runtime concepts and how to use them in your modernization project.

**Topics**
+ [AWS Transform for mainframe releases](ba-releases.md)
+ [AWS Transform for mainframe Runtime concepts](ba-shared-concept.md)
+ [Set up configuration for AWS Transform for mainframe Runtime](ba-runtime-config.md)
+ [AWS Transform for mainframe Runtime Error Codes](ba-runtime-error-codes.md)
+ [AWS Transform for mainframe Runtime APIs](ba-runtime-endpoints.md)
+ [AWS Transform for mainframe Runtime Utilities](system-utilities.md)
+ [Set up AWS Transform for mainframe Runtime](ba-runtime-setup.md)
+ [Modify the source code with AWS Transform for mainframe Developer IDE](ba-modify-source.md)
+ [AWS Transform for mainframe FAQ](ba-faq.md)